About Our Center
The Northwell Roybal Center for Personalized Trials works to develop behavioral interventions and adequately powered clinical trial results that can be translated into scalable, implementable interventions through innovative mechanisms of behavior change, behavior change theories and techniques, and innovative personalized methods.

Eligibility Requirements
Propose a fully powered randomized clinical trial — not a pilot or feasibility study
Apply the NIH Stage Model, with clear articulation of progression through stages
Target walking behavior in individuals with MCI or dementia
Include adequate statistical power to test mechanisms of behavior change and/or efficacy
Demonstrate grounding in a behavior change theory
Operate within a $200,000 total-cost budget over one year
